Yorkshire sports technology firm continues growth with new clients
A Sheffield sports technology specialist has secured partnerships with two more national governing bodies of sport.
Sport:80 develops cloud-based business management software and has begun work with USA Water Polo and Wales Netball.
The two new partnerships contribute to Sport:80’s year-on-year growth of 25 per cent in 2021, up from 16 per cent in 2020, while the number of full-time staff in the business has increased from 12 to 15 across the calendar year.
Both new partnerships will mark the governing bodies’ transition from legacy systems, to delivering digital services to athletes, coaches, officials, and clubs, using Sport:80’s flagship ‘Platform’ service.
